A kinetic study of osmium tetroxide catalysed oxidation of methyl digol and ethyl digol by hexacyanoferrate (III) in aqueous alkaline medium
(Department of Chemistry, University of Allahabad, Allahabad.), India.
The osmium tetroxide catalysed reactions of alkaline hexacyanoferrate. (III) with methyl digol and ethyl digol were investigated kinetically. The reactions are zero order in hexajanoferrate (III) and of first order in substrate and osmium tetroxide concentrations. With an increase in [math] the rate increased and the reaction showed positive intercept at Y-axis. An inner-sphere mechanism involving complex formation, which then disproportionates to form the products, is suggested.
